Parallel semantic processing in reading revisited: effects of translation equivalents in bilingual readers.

Previous research has failed to establish semantic parafoveal-on-foveal effects during reading. As an explanation, we theorise that sentence reading engages a sentence-level representation that prevents semantic parafoveal-foveal integration.
